Hearing Notices

A notice of hearing is a legal document that announces an AER hearing. We hold hearings to make decisions on applications, regulatory appeals, and reconsiderations.

We publish all hearing notices to this page and often in local or regional newspapers (print or online). 

Why It’s Important

  1. The notice of hearing tells you where to get more information about the proposed project and the hearing.
  2. The notice of hearing also explains how you can apply to participate in the hearing. If you want to participate, you must file a request by the deadline set out in the notice of hearing. If you miss the deadline, you might not be allowed to participate.
  3. If you are approved to participate in the hearing, you may be eligible to recover some costs associated with participating in the hearing. Before spending money, see Directive 031: REDA Energy Cost Claims.

We also issue other notices related to hearings, including scheduling, rescheduling, adjourning, or cancelling hearings.
